Bothriostylops notios
Taxonomy
Bothriostylops notios was named by Zheng and Huang (1986). Its type specimen is IVPP V7642, a mandible (Left lower jaw), and it is a 3D body fossil. Its type locality is North of Zhulin Hill, which is in a Paleocene terrestrial horizon in the Chijiang Formation of China. It is the type species of Bothriostylops.
